Wests Tigers winger David Nofoaluma has capped off his finest season in the NRL by being named the Dally M Winger of the Year for 2020.
Nofoaluma was named in the new-look Dally M Team of the Year in tonightβs awards ceremony at Fox Sports Studios, with Melbourne Storm winger Josh Addo-Carr named as the other winger in the illustrious 13-man group.
The Campbelltown junior is just the second Wests Tigers winger to be named in the Dally M Team of the Year with Taniela Tuiaki selected in his record-breaking in 2009 season.
The honour puts an exclamation point on Nofoalumaβs superb 2020 campaign that also saw him clinch the clubβs Kelly-Barnes Award and Playersβ Player Award.
One of just three Wests Tigers players to feature in every game this season, Nofoaluma finished the year with a career-high 17 tries while also contributing more runs, metres and tackle breaks than any other outside back in the competition.

2020 DALLY M TEAM OF THE YEAR
- Fullback β Clint Gutherson (Parramatta Eels)
- Winger β David Nofoaluma (Wests Tigers)
- Winger β Josh Addo-Carr (Melbourne Storm)
- Centre β Stephen Crichton (Penrith Panthers)
- Centre β Kotoni Staggs (Brisbane Broncos)
- Five-Eighth β Jack Wighton (Canberra Raiders)
- Halfback β Nathan Cleary (Penrith Panthers)
- Front Row β Josh Papalii (Canberra Raiders)
- Front Row β James Fisher-Harris (Penrith Panthers)
- Second Row β Tohu Harris (New Zealand Warriors)
- Second Row β Viliame Kikau (Penrith Panthers)
- Hooker β Cameron Smith (Melbourne Storm)
- Captain β Roger Tuivasa-Sheck (New Zealand Warriors)
- Coach β Ivan Cleary (Penrith Panthers)
